Westerfield Station might not be the largest, but it offers essential facilities to keep your journey on track. While there isn't a ticket office, rest assured—ticket machines are available for both pur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ets. Accessibility is a priority here with the availability of step-free access to both platforms, accessible ticket machines, and induction loops for those with hearing aids.
Informational services are a strong suit, with departure screens and announcements keeping passengers in the know. Help is available via customer help points, and there's CCTV for added security. Though lacking in wa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, a seating area offers a respite as you wait for your train.
For those keen on exploring the surrounding area, it’s important to note that rail replacement bus services don't serve Westerfield. If in need, Ipswich station is your go-to for this service. While the station is minimal in taxi and car hire options, bicycle enthusiasts will find limited but available cycle storage facilities—ideal for those continuing their journey on two wheels.

While compact, Godstone station provides essential facilities that cater to the needs of its travelers. Though there’s no ticket office, ticket machines are available and fully equipped to handle ticket collections and sales, including those with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. For those needing assistance, Godstone features a help point system on its platforms and has induction loops for those with hearing impairments.
In terms of accessibility, Godstone is classified as a Category B3 station. There is step-free access in certain areas via a long and somewhat steep ramp, providing access to platform 2. Unfortunately, platform 1 requires the use of steps, and passengers requiring assistance are encouraged to make arrangements beforehand. Although there isn’t staff available at Godstone, helpful on-board staff is ready to assist passengers with boarding where needed. Other facilities include a seating area, payphones, as well as limited bicycle storage with CCTV for security.
